Can you be a navy diver with glasses?

Can you be a navy diver with glasses? Yes. It depends on how bad your vision is though and it can be corrected. The qualifying requirements are: Eyesight 20/200 bilateral correctable to 20/25 with no color blindness.

Can you be a diver with glasses? No you cannot do scuba diving with glasses. The design of eyeglasses means that the arms of the glasses that clip over your ears do not allow the plastic or silicon skirt of the dive mask to seal correctly over your face.

What is the axis on a glasses prescription?

Axis – If an eyeglass prescription includes cylinder power, it also must include an axis value, which follows the CYL power. The axis indicates the angle (in degrees) between the two meridians of an astigmatic eye. The axis is defined with a number from 1 to 180.

How do i get the film off my glasses?

You can remove the buildup caused by calcium and magnesium ions in hard water by swabbing the glass with acetone (nail polish remover), and then scrub gently with a mild detergent. Soaking the glasses in plain white distilled vinegar for 15 minutes is another effective home remedy.

Do movie theatre glasses work on 3d tvs?

Movie theaters typically use RealD 3D glasses, which are passive 3D glasses and these will absolutely work with your 3D system at home, providing it also supports passive 3D technology. While active 3D technology is the most common type, movie theater glasses will work in your home if you have a passive system.

What happens if you stare at the eclipse without glasses?

Exposing your eyes to the sun without proper eye protection during a solar eclipse can cause “eclipse blindness” or retinal burns, also known as solar retinopathy. This exposure to the light can cause damage or even destroy cells in the retina (the back of the eye) that transmit what you see to the brain.

How to tell if my eclipse glasses are good?

The reflected sunlight or bright, white, artificial light should appear very dim through a safe pair of eclipse glasses. If you can see light behind a lamp shade or a soft, frosted light bulb through the glasses through your eclipse glasses, then they aren’t strong enough to stare safely at the sun.

Can water being too soft make glasses cloudy?

Ironically, soft water can also cause glasses to cloud, although this was more of a problem when dishwasher detergents were formulated with phosphates. Combined with very hot water, the phosphates could change into a form that would eat into glass, causing etching that’s impossible to remove.

Can u repair scratched glasses?

Unfortunately, it’s not possible to repair a scratch on your lens as it will have caused permanent damage to the lens surface or treatment. If a scratch is found, your optician can order a new pair of lenses to fit your frames.
